Cut costs with smarter inventory optimization and demand forecasting
Inventory is one of the largest cost levers for uniform suppliers. Excess SKUs and poor forecasting inflate holding costs and markdowns; stockouts trigger emergency freight and dissatisfied customers.
Tactics to reduce inventory cost
- Demand forecasting: Build demand models from historical sales, enrollment trends, and seasonality. Factor in school calendars and uniform policy changes.
- Inventory optimization: Classify SKUs by velocity (ABC analysis) and apply differentiated reorder points and safety-stock rules for high- and low-velocity items.
- RFID and barcode systems: Use RFID or barcode inventory systems to automate counts, reduce shrinkage, and accelerate replenishment cycles. See the GS1 EPC/RFID standards and implementation guide for best practices: https://www.gs1.org/standards/epc-rfid.
- JIT and mass customization: Use just-in-time production for basic styles with nearby contract manufacturers. Apply mass customization (badges, monograms, house colors) to reduce finished-goods inventory while meeting bespoke needs.
- Supplier consolidation: Consolidate suppliers to gain scale discounts and simplify logistics, while maintaining a second-source plan for risk mitigation.

Strengthen compliance and supplier relationship management
Suppliers must meet safety standards, labeling and packaging rules, and supplier code-of-conduct expectations. Strong supplier relationship management (SRM) and vendor controls reduce compliance risk and improve production reliability.
Best practices
- Vendor qualification and audits: Screen suppliers for safety certifications and labor compliance. Perform regular third-party or in-house audits.
- Contracts and SLAs: Define SLAs for on-time delivery, defect rates, and remediation timelines. Tie incentives or penalties to KPI performance.
- Quality control: Add checkpoints at fabric receipt, in-line production, and pre-shipment inspection. Use sample approvals and batch testing to limit defects.
- Textile traceability: Work with suppliers who can provide fiber-level traceability (e.g., Sorona content or recycled polyester provenance) to substantiate sustainability and compliance claims.
- Lead-time management: Map lead times by supplier and SKU. For critical items, maintain local buffers or shift production to nearby manufacturers to shorten lead times.
Tools to integrate: procurement software + ERP integration for end-to-end visibility, and supplier portals to centralize documents, certifications, and performance dashboards. Formalizing SLAs and tracking defect rates and on-time delivery turns SRM into a proactive cost-control lever rather than a reactive firefight.

Roadmap — how to implement optimized uniform supply chain solutions
A pragmatic rollout:
- Audit current state (30 days): Map suppliers, lead times, SKUs, returns, and compliance documentation. Establish baseline KPIs: forecast accuracy, turnover, DOH, defect rate, on-time delivery.
- Pilot inventory visibility tools (60–90 days): Implement barcode or RFID on a subset of high-volume SKUs and integrate with procurement software/ERP to automate reorders.
- Consolidate and negotiate (90–150 days): Identify top suppliers and negotiate consolidated contracts with SLAs, volume discounts, and sustainability clauses. Define second-source plans for critical items.
- Quality, traceability & compliance (ongoing): Schedule audits, require traceability documents, and standardize packaging and labeling.
- Sustainability & circularity pilot (6–12 months): Test a district-level take-back or repair program and introduce eco-fabrics in new launches (e.g., Sorona SmartFlex lines).
- Scale and measure (12 months+): Expand successful pilots, report SLAs and KPIs, and iterate.
Quick wins: start an RFID/barcode pilot with a small SKU pool; negotiate reduced lead times for core basics to lower safety stock; use supplier scorecards to reward top performers and manage underperformers.
